WinPE制作教程:从基础到进阶
需积分: 9 96 浏览量
更新于2024-11-24
收藏 174KB TXT 举报
"WinPE制作基础知识教程"
WinPE(Windows Preinstallation Environment)是微软提供的一种轻量级操作系统,主要用于系统安装、维护、故障恢复等场景。对于初学者来说,了解WinPE的制作过程和基本原理是非常重要的。
1. **WinPE配置文件**:在WinPE的构建中,`WinPE.INI` 是关键配置文件,它通常位于 `%WINDIR%\System32\PEConfig.INI`。这个文件包含了PE系统的设置和启动参数,例如启动时的超时时间等。
2. **启动菜单**:`menu.lst` 文件是Grub4Dos的配置文件,用于定义启动选项和菜单界面。在这个文件中,你可以指定启动的PE映像位置、加载驱动器以及各种启动参数。
3. **注册表导入**:`regedit.exe` 可用于将注册表信息(如 `setupreg.hiv`)导入到PE环境中,以确保PE能够识别和配置必要的系统设置。
4. **Grub4Dos**:这是一个引导装载程序,常用于WinPE的启动。`grubinst_gui.exe` 是其图形界面安装工具,可以用来安装Grub4Dos到硬盘的MBR(主引导记录)或BS(扇区)。
5. **分区类型**:在创建WinPE的过程中,你需要选择合适的分区格式,如FAT12、FAT16、FAT32、EXT2或EXT3。同时,如果目标系统是MBR类型的,需要将Grub4Dos安装到MBR。
6. **安装确认**:成功安装Grub4Dos后,会显示提示信息"The MBR/BS has been successfully installed",表示安装过程顺利完成。
7. **Grub4Dos配置**:Grub4Dos的配置文件`menu.lst`需要编辑,以定义启动项。在FAT16/FAT32分区上,Grub4Dos会自动处理;而在非FAT16/FAT32分区,比如NTFS,需要手动配置Grub4Dos来加载MBR或BS。
8. **引导扇区大小**:Grub4Dos的引导扇区大小需要根据实际环境进行调整,通常默认值即可。
9. **启动流程**:WinPE的启动通常涉及到`AVLDR.PE`、`PELDR`、`WINNT.SIF`等文件。`AVLDR.PE` 在启动时加载,然后是`PELDR`,接着是PE系统的根目录,最后`WINNT.SIF`文件包含了系统安装的相关信息。
10. **WinNT.SIF配置**:`[SetupData]` 部分的设置指定了启动设备、启动路径、系统加载选项等。例如,`BootDevice` 设置启动设备,`BootPath` 指定系统文件路径,`OsLoadOptions` 包含了启动时传递给系统的参数。
制作WinPE需要理解操作系统的基本原理,熟悉注册表、引导装载程序、分区格式以及相关配置文件的用法。这不仅有利于自定义个人化的WinPE,也对系统管理和维护能力的提升大有裨益。通过不断实践和学习,初学者可以逐步掌握这一技术,为日常的IT工作带来便利。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2012-04-28 上传
2008-12-28 上传
2021-10-06 上传
2012-04-28 上传
2011-02-25 上传
2024-01-12 上传
startbirdok
- 粉丝: 0
- 资源: 1
最新资源
- R语言中workflows包的建模工作流程解析
- Vue统计工具项目配置与开发指南
- 基于Spearman相关性的协同过滤推荐引擎分析
- Git基础教程:掌握版本控制精髓
- RISCBoy: 探索开源便携游戏机的设计与实现
- iOS截图功能案例:TKImageView源码分析
- knowhow-shell: 基于脚本自动化作业的完整tty解释器
- 2011版Flash幻灯片管理系统:多格式图片支持
- Khuli-Hawa计划:城市空气质量与噪音水平记录
- D3-charts:轻松定制笛卡尔图表与动态更新功能
- 红酒品质数据集深度分析与应用
- BlueUtils: 经典蓝牙操作全流程封装库的介绍
- Typeout:简化文本到HTML的转换工具介绍与使用
- LeetCode动态规划面试题494解法精讲
- Android开发中RxJava与Retrofit的网络请求封装实践
- React-Webpack沙箱环境搭建与配置指南